Removendo anexo de PDF
Contents
[
Hide
]
Aspose.PDF pode remover anexos de arquivos PDF. Os anexos de um documento PDF são mantidos na coleção EmbeddedFiles do objeto Document.
O seguinte trecho de código também funciona com a biblioteca Aspose.PDF.Drawing.
Para deletar todos os anexos associados a um arquivo PDF:
- Chame o método Delete da coleção EmbeddedFiles.
- Salve o arquivo atualizado usando o método Save do objeto Document.
O seguinte trecho de código mostra como remover anexos de um documento PDF.
// Para exemplos completos e arquivos de dados, por favor vá para https://github.com/aspose-pdf/Aspose.PDF-for-.NET
// O caminho para o diretório de documentos.
string dataDir = RunExamples.GetDataDir_AsposePdf_Attachments();
// Abrir documento
Document pdfDocument = new Document(dataDir + "DeleteAllAttachments.pdf");
// Deletar todos os anexos
pdfDocument.EmbeddedFiles.Delete();
// Salvar documento atualizado
pdfDocument.Save(dataDir + "DeleteAllAnnotationsFromPage_out.pdf");